S is for SPLIT. Income splitting is a strategy that involves transferring a portion of greenbacks from someone can be in a high tax bracket to a person who is from a lower tax segment. It may even be possible to lessen tax on the transferred income to zero if this person, doesn't possess any other taxable income. Normally, the other person is either your spouse or common-law spouse, but it can also be your children. Whenever it is possible to transfer income to a person in a lower tax bracket, it must be done. If major difference between tax rates is 20% then your family will save $200 for every $1,000 transferred for the "lower rate" family member.

Getting transfer pricing back to the decision of which legal entity to choose, let's take each one separately. The most widespread form of legal entity is the organization. There are two basic forms, C Corp and S Corp. A C Corp pays tax based on its profit for last year and then any dividends paid to shareholders can also taxed. Hence the term double-taxation. An S Corp however works differently. The S Corp pays no tax on profits. The profit flows to the shareholders who then pay tax on that money. The big difference yet another excellent that the 15.3% self-employment tax does not apply. So, by forming an S Corporation, enterprise saves $3,060 for 2011 on real money of $20,000. The tax still applies, but Seen someone would choose pay $1,099 than $4,159. That is a large savings.
